Sana Biotechnology Inc. is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company focused on creating and delivering engineered cells as medicines for patients. The company is developing cell therapies for various diseases, including oncology, diabetes, and central nervous system disorders. Sana's core strategy is built around two key technological platforms: in vivo gene delivery to repair cells inside the body and ex vivo cell engineering for therapeutic use.

The company owns and operates a large fleet of bulk carriers, primarily transporting major commodities such as iron ore, coal, and grain. SBLK focuses on the Capesize, Post Panamax, and Kamsarmax vessel segments, providing critical logistical services to commodity producers and consumers worldwide.
